Transaction 8f34bfa60d507138446c57659f2b396fc46d0176a1999070744677df93ccdf45

5 Input
2 Outputs
  • 8f34bfa60d507138446c57659f2b396fc46d0176a1999070744677df93ccdf45:0
  • value  7980000
    address  3CQaciBJKyJ9sqrLAMRjfaE4RqDbJTgHyn
  • 8f34bfa60d507138446c57659f2b396fc46d0176a1999070744677df93ccdf45:1
  • value  89317483
    address  3CKprffahvPfyywWftjMbwaRdtKKGomfYt